Barbera d’Asti Lavignone by Pico Maccario is a complex and structured red wine. During the years, it became one of the most important and prestigious wines of the cellar. It is produced with 100% Barbera grapes, cultivated on hills full of minerals, due to the ancient presence of lakes.
The manual harvest consists in a careful selection of the grapes. Once the bunches reach the cellar, the soft pressing starts, followed by 10-12 days maceration. The aging is developed in steel tanks for 9 months. After the bottling, the wine matures a few months before the selling. The vineyards are located in the prestigious DOCG area of Mombaruzzo, in the district of Asti. The harvest is organized at the end of September.
